sub build_wxwidgets {
    my( $self ) = shift;
    my $old_dir = Cwd::cwd();

    $self->My::Build::Win32_Bakefile::build_wxwidgets( @_ );

    # Compiling with MSVC 9 (VS 2008) and probably with VS 2005, the
    # linker creates a manifest that must be embedded in the DLL to
    # make it load correctly
    chdir File::Spec->catdir( $ENV{WXDIR} );
    foreach my $dll ( glob( 'lib/vc_dll*/*.dll' ) ) {
        next unless -f "${dll}.manifest";
        $self->_system( 'mt', '-nologo', '-manifest', "${dll}.manifest",
                        "-outputresource:${dll};2" );
        unlink "${dll}.manifest";
    }

    chdir $old_dir;
}
